### Account recovery: Siftgate bloom filter

If an account lookup returns a false "not found," the Siftgate bloom filter in front of the Corvel key-value store may be corrupted. Do not rebuild it live; restore from the nightly snapshot instead. The snapshot archive is encrypted, and decrypting it requires the recovery passphrase noted directly below.

recovery phrase for bawep-kawef: oliath-casdor

Meeting notes — Records team catch-up, Thistledown office

Quick recap on the ledger archiving: the 2016–2019 books are finally boxed up — nine crates, all sealed and labelled, sitting in the back room. Priya's double-checked the index sheets against the register, so we're good there. Crates go out Thursday with Hollowbrook Couriers; please don't let anyone reopen them before then. Hand-over instruction for the pick-up is below.

dispatch memo: the eliok quenok courier leaves the sorael aldath belion tammir casix gileth queniel jorath ledger at gate 9299 under passcode 897989

**Q: The markdown pipeline rejected my release notes — what now?**

A: The Inkmill renderer enforces strict front-matter validation before publishing. If your notes fail, check for unclosed fences and unsupported HTML tags first; the linter output lists exact line numbers. Release managers can override a false positive by unlocking the pipeline's admin mode, which is gated behind the sealed credentials store. To open that store, enter the passphrase below.

strongbox words: zorwyn-sorael-belion-ulaius-silmir-ulays-briax-rusdor-gorix

Subject: Restock planner cut-over — done!

Hi, and welcome aboard! Quick recap since you missed the fun: we moved the Snackwise restock planner off the old nightly spreadsheet job and onto the live Pellerin scheduler on Tuesday. Route suggestions now refresh every two hours instead of once a day, and the Fenwick depot pilot went smoothly — only one hiccup with stale machine inventories, already fixed. When you set up your local instance, use the configuration values below.

deployment values, faduf-tawep:
SORDOR_LOG_LEVEL=error
SORDOR_METRICS_HOST=metrics.sordor.nelvrolabs.internal
SORDOR_POOL_SIZE=4